As Michael was bolting out the door for rehearsal he called to tell me that he was cited in an article in the Warrensburg Daily Star-Journal:

Most tenured faculty favored keeping Podolefsky. Some, including Michael Bersin, seek to connect board members who voted against retention to the athletic department, where they say opposition to Podolefsky is strongest.

Well, they got that right. That is exactly what we are seeking to do. But no one called Michael up and interviewed him, so they got their information by accessing his body of work here.

So we are curious...has anyone at the Star-Journal been filing Sunshine requests, too? The dots are out there to be connected, and whoever connects them first gets the scoop.
